Why Choose Advanced ISM Code, Lead Auditor & DPA Roles Training Course?
This Advanced ISM Code, Lead Auditor & DPA Roles training course has been designed by ISM experts to meet with the criteria of the IMO Guidelines contained in Circular MSC – MEPC.7 Circ. 6 (19 October 2007), but it has also been developed with much practical knowledge of both the shipping industry and the legal issues that surround the role of the DPA.
The aim of the training course is to provide knowledge, understanding and proficiency necessary to understand ISM code and also to provide training for all DPAs (and those preparing to become DPAs) so that they can fully understand their responsibilities and roles of this important position with respect to full compliance with the ISM Code.
The training course covers the requirements related to lead auditor responsibilities respectively and finally the issues and factors that affect ISM Audits.
